Output 17650f5972c7e86ae11edd72230fb50ca03d8214fe56eb857f638ffa52cad1c7:0

value
1905627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e7a036f06f6465b5e7a7f7c0024fccada98f92 OP_EQUAL
address
3FinnYE6tNPjass6C1v4zQERPcu9NS35tV
transaction
17650f5972c7e86ae11edd72230fb50ca03d8214fe56eb857f638ffa52cad1c7
confirmations
503700
spent
true